Xavius is a masculine name with English origins. It is pronounced as ZAY-vee-uhs (/ˈzeɪviəs/). This name is a variation of the popular name Xavier. Xavius has been given to babies in the United States since at least 1989, and its popularity has remained relatively consistent over the years. In recent years, it has ranked around 7th to 11th in terms of occurrence, with approximately 5 to 14 newborns being named Xavius each year.
